Domestic Cats or Cat Breeds?

Mimi: Domestic or Purebred? Who Cares?

The cats we enjoy as pets today are all domesticated, in that they all descend from a common origin centuries ago. So what is the difference between "domestic cats" and "purebreds?" Is one better than another in terms of beauty and companionship?

Cat Breed of the Week: Scottish Fold

Wednesday August 27, 2008
The foremost characteristic distinguishing the Scottish Fold cat is its small ears which fold forward and downward, giving it an impish look. Scottish Fold kittens are not born with folded ears. The ears of the kittens that carry the gene start folding usually about the 21st day, starting with the outer edge of the ear near the base.

Sweet-tempered and attentive, devoted, but not demanding, the "Fold" makes a perfect pet. As the fold is outcrossed with both American and British Shorthair cats, think of it as as having a "British sense of decorum along with an American sense of self-confidence," according to The International Scottish Fold Association.
